Hey Priya — handing over the tide-table widget for the Gullport harbor app. The chart renders fine now; the offset bug was a timezone thing in the Moonline library. One loose end: the cached predictions store is sealed after my laptop wipe. For the weekly sync, note that reopening it needs the recovery passphrase below.

vault phrase of tajef-tafog = istox-sorax-zorox-casok-holox-kelix-weneth-drueth-casion

## Deployment

Reviewer notes: the Lanternbox build now uses a two-stage image. The builder stage compiles against full toolchains; the runtime stage copies only the stripped binary and certs, dropping the image from 1.1 GB to 84 MB. Please verify no debug symbols leak into the final layer. The slimmed image ships with the following defaults baked in.

service settings:
[casax]
port = 6379
team = rusir
host = casax.zemvarhq.corp
region = outer-4
access_code = ac_9808ce
timeout_ms = 1500

**Runbook: Pickwise Route Stalls**

If the Drayton Depot pick-list optimizer stops emitting routes, first check the solver heartbeat in the Fennick console. A stale heartbeat usually means the bin-inventory feed is lagging; restart the ingest worker and wait two cycles. Do not clear the route cache unless instructed by the on-call lead. Full escalation steps and restart commands are on the internal page below.

operations page: https://jira.qorvelsys.internal/browse/pages/browse/pages

Ticket: Crashlight vault locked, blocking crash-report symbolication. Since Tuesday, the mobile crash-report pipeline for the Ember app has been unable to decrypt incoming reports because the symbolication vault auto-sealed after a node reboot. Reports are queuing safely, nothing is lost, but dashboards are stale. For the weekly sync: we need one maintainer to unseal it before Friday. The unseal prompt requires the recovery passphrase recorded below:

unlock words, hahip-baduf: holwyn-istath-julvan

Key ceremony checklist — item 4, for the weekly eng sync. Verify that the signing key for VramScope, our GPU memory profiling tool, has been rotated and that both custodians from the Hollowmere infra team witnessed the sealing. Record the ceremony timestamp in the ledger. Before sealing the backup shard, the facilitator reads aloud and archives the recovery passphrase written below.

unlock words, yagag-yahog: gordor-zorvan-druius-queniel-normir-norwyn-framir-novmir-ralius-holwyn-wenwyn-tamael-silok-holdor